The 'Making of Gemini' is an intriguing peek into the creative chaos behind Shin'ya Tsukamoto's film. It captures the raw energy and unsettling atmosphere that Tsukamoto is known for. The pacing feels almost like a visual diary, meandering through the process of crafting such a visceral film. You'll find interviews with the crew that reflect their passion, and those practical effects are really something to behold—there's a tactile quality that modern CGI often misses. It’s not just about the finished product but the journey itself, showcasing the relentless drive that defines Tsukamoto’s work. This documentary gives a rare glimpse into both the art and the struggle, making it a distinctive insight into his filmmaking philosophy.
